APCO Worldwide - a global advisory and advocacy firm - is looking for a dynamic public affairs / communications professional to drive APCO's Japan business with a broad range of international clients. The role will be based in Tokyo with some domestic travel and occasional travel to other markets.

A Senior Consultant manages large and small client projects, prepares client-ready materials, reviews junior team members' work, and oversees tasks and workflow. They conduct research on macro business issues impacting clients, coordinate client meetings and events, and complete deliverables under supervision. Senior Consultants demonstrate an understanding of APCO's business practices and processes, possess strong communication skills, and interface with all levels of staff and client organizations. They are also involved in new business proposal development and the management of junior staff and teams.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Prepare and lead customized credential packages for prospective clients, highlighting APCO capabilities, relevant case studies, and high-level industry notes and observations (requiring little to no revisions by managers)
  • Able to approve complete proposals for client work showing strategic thought, scope or work and pricing. Works with an understanding of APCO's tools, business model, and structure
  • Identify ways to expand client engagement and take initiative with appropriate contacts to pursue expansion of work
  • Participate actively in internal and client meetings, sometimes leading them, offering knowledgeable observations and suggestions; maintain awareness of "air time" and foster participation of other colleagues
  • Lead effective brainstorming sessions
  • Be able to maintain independent contact with client in providing service; maintain email/telephone contacts with clients as needed, without requiring a supervisor to intervene
  • Demonstrates confidence and projects the presence of a consultant in client engagements (on phone, in person, with prospects)
  • Prepare comprehensive reports and deliverables required in the specific functional capacity (e.g., perception audits, market studies, provincial reports, etc.) with minimal guidance and review by managers
  • Proactively identify external meetings and trainings to attend to build sector knowledge and contacts.
  • Meets or exceeds assigned utilization targets
  • Manages on a macro level and oversees the work of more junior colleagues, providing feedback and ensuring the quality of work

QUALIFICATIONS AND STANDARDS 

EDUCATION: University Degree

EXPERIENCE:  7-9 years relevant experience in a consulting firm, corporation, diplomatic posting or media role

LANGUAGES: Full proficiency in both English (TOEIC 900+) and Japanese language (JPLT-N1 for non-native speakers

APCO IN TOKYO

APCO's Tokyo-based team prides itself on a proven record of advising multinational companies to realize strategic advantage and achieve their top- and bottom-line business goals by:​

  • Aligning with societal and government priorities​
  • Anticipating potential issues and mitigating negative risks​
  • Navigating regulatory scrutiny and using regulation to call out others​
  • Responding rapidly to crises to maintain and rebuild reputation ​
  • Identifying and engaging key local stakeholders and third-parties​
  • Advocating for policies that create or expand their market ​

Our clients—a majority of whom draw from the health and tech industries–choose APCO for our unique combination of global mindset and local market knowledge and relationships. They trust that our insights and ideas will properly balance what's needed in Japan with the increasingly complex geopolitics of their business and with the uncertainties wrought by climate change, pandemic threats, rising prices, growing inequality, disinformation and various forms of ethnic and political tribalism. ​

Delivering on that promise is our diverse team of consultants, who have studied or worked in a dozen countries and who speak at least a half-dozen languages. Their international experience and perspectives enable us to deliver unmatched, world-class counsel and service that sets our clients apart and sets them up for continued success in Japan and beyond.
